Currently existing Java RS coders based on {{GaloisField}} implementation have some drawbacks or limitations: * The decoder computes not really erased units unnecessarily (HADOOP-11871); * The decoder requires parity units + data units order for the inputs in the decode API (HADOOP-12040); * Need to support or align with native erasure coders regarding concrete coding algorithms and matrix, so Java coders and native coders can be easily swapped in/out and transparent to HDFS (HADOOP-12010); * It's unnecessarily flexible but incurs some overhead, as HDFS erasure coding is totally a byte based data system, we don't need to consider other symbol size instead of 256. This desires to re-implement the underlying facilities for the Java RS coders, getting rid of existing {{GaliosField}} from HDFS-RAID. Based on this work, Java RS coders will be re-implemented easily as well to resolve related issues. -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.4#6332)
